My 30' x 40' metal building is what it is. Hot in the summer and cold in the winter. I like it and I use it a lot. But there are days when it is just to off the scale to get any work done.
I build hot rods one at a time. So, while I need storage and dirty work space I would also like a nice, climate controlled space to assemble chassis, motors, and the like.
My first thought was to build a shop within the shop. But this is not really workable.
So, my thoughts have turned to a stand alone single car garage with some depth. I'm kicking around 16' to 18' wide and 26' to 30' long. 8' or 9' ceiling height. Insulated and dry walled with a simple through the wall motel type HVAC system.
This is not going to be a daily in and out garage. So a conventional over head door and opener are not required. In fact, I don't want to deal with the trackage. I'd like this to be as neat and finished as I can make it.
So, what are my alternative options? The one that comes to mind is a double swinging door. One side would work as an entry and the other would open when I need to bring a chassis or complete hot rod inside for some TLC.
Is this practical? I spent about an hour searching for this kind of double door without success. Does such a door even exist?
